Inspector’s narrative

What the inspector wrote

According to staff, to alleviate pressure in bed and prevent R1 from developing pressure ulcers, facility requested a hospital bed with pressure relieving mattress, staff turned and repositioned R1 every 2 hours and provided incontinence care every 2 hours to ensure R1 was cleaned and dry. Based on documents provided by the facility, on 3/5/2022, facility staff noted R1 developed a pressure ulcer. The facility staff completed a change of condition and notified R1's physician. While waiting for the physician to respond, facility provided treatment to R1's wound. Subsequently, R1's physician ordered a home health referral for wound evaluation and management. In addition, facility conducted a virtual appointment with R1's physician and R1's responsible party concerning the pressure ulcer. On 4/18/2022, R1's wound was noted to be stage 3 by the home health nurse and R1 was transferred to the hospital on the next day for worsening of the wound. Base on record review and interviews during the course of investigation, this allegation is unsubstantiated as the facility provided actions to prevent R1 from getting pressure ulcers but due to R1's health condition, R1 developed pressure ulcer and when it was noted by the facility, the facility took actions. Although the above investigations may have happened or are valid, there is not a preponderance of evidence to prove the alleged violations did or did not occur, therefore the allegation is UNSUBSTANTIATED. This report is discussed and reviewed with the administrator. A copy is provided.
